Obtaining Your California Dealer License: The Ultimate Checklist Resource
Embarking on the journey to become a licensed automobile dealer in California can seem daunting, but with a well-structured plan and comprehensive understanding of the requirements, you can navigate this process effectively. This ultimate checklist serves as your guide, outlining the essential steps involved in securing your California Dealer License.
- Confirm Your Requirements by consulting the California Department of Motor Vehicles (DMV) website for detailed information on licensing criteria.
- Deliver a completed and accurate dealer license application to the DMV. This application typically includes personal information, business details, and documentation of financial stability.
- Pass a thorough background check conducted by the California Department of Justice (DOJ).
- Acquire a surety bond to protect consumers from potential financial losses. The amount of the bond is determined by the DMV based on your business operations.
- Set up a designated business location that meets all regulatory requirements.
- Fulfill continuing education obligations as set forth by the DMV.
- Maintain accurate and up-to-date records of all business transactions and customer interactions.
